| Error Message | Likely Cause | Solution |
|---------------|--------------|----------|
| Device not found | Wrong driver or USB port | Reinstall USB driver; try USB 2.0 port |
| Bad block too many | Physically failing NAND | Tool cannot repair – replace drive |
| Download ISP fail | Firmware mismatch | Find correct firmware version for your flash die |
| Format fail at 99% | Controller hang or power loss | Restart tool, lower ScanLevel to 2 |
| Write protected | Logical lock or hardware switch | Set EraseAll=1; if still fails, drive is likely dead |
